Tips for Travelers: Navigating iOS Updates at the Airport
Okay, so you're heading to the airport and you've just updated your iPhone to the latest iOS version. What should you do to ensure a smooth experience? First and foremost, make sure you have a backup plan. If you're relying on a mobile boarding pass, consider taking a screenshot or printing out a paper copy just in case. This can save you a lot of headaches if the airport's system isn't fully compatible with the new iOS version. Next, be aware of potential Wi-Fi issues. Before you connect to the airport's Wi-Fi network, check to see if there are any known issues with the latest iOS version. You can usually find this information on Apple's support website or on the airport's website. If you're experiencing connectivity problems, try restarting your device or switching to a different network. Another tip is to keep your essential apps updated. Airport apps, airline apps, and travel apps are constantly being updated to address compatibility issues and improve performance. Make sure you have the latest versions installed before you head to the airport. Also, consider disabling automatic updates while you're traveling. While it's generally a good idea to keep your device up-to-date, automatic updates can sometimes cause unexpected problems. If you're in the middle of an important task, such as checking in for your flight, you don't want your device to suddenly restart and install an update. Finally, don't be afraid to ask for help. If you're experiencing any issues with your device or the airport's systems, don't hesitate to ask an airport employee or an Apple support representative for assistance. They may be able to provide you with a quick fix or direct you to the appropriate resources. By following these simple tips, you can navigate iOS updates at the airport with confidence and minimize the potential for disruptions.
